Why Do Wheel Bolts Become Loose?
Understanding why wheel bolts become loose is essential for maintaining vehicle safety. Here are the primary reasons:
1. Improper Torque Application
One of the most common causes of loose wheel bolts is the incorrect application of torque during installation. When bolts are not tightened to the manufacturer’s specified torque, they can loosen over time. This can occur if:
- A torque wrench is not used.
- The torque settings are incorrect.
- The bolts are not tightened in the correct sequence.
2. Thermal Expansion and Contraction
Thermal expansion is another factor that can cause wheel bolts to loosen. As a vehicle’s wheels heat up during use, the metal expands. When the wheels cool down, the metal contracts. This cycle can gradually loosen bolts, especially if they were not initially tightened to the correct specifications.
3. Vibration and Road Conditions
Driving on rough roads or over long distances can cause vibrations that may loosen wheel bolts. This is particularly true for vehicles driven off-road or on poorly maintained surfaces. Consistent exposure to these conditions can exacerbate the problem.
4. Wear and Tear
Over time, wheel bolts and their corresponding holes in the wheel can wear down. This wear can result in a less secure fit, making it easier for the bolts to come loose. Regular inspection and maintenance can help mitigate this issue.
How to Prevent Wheel Bolts from Becoming Loose
Preventing wheel bolts from loosening is vital for safety. Here are some practical steps:
- Use a Torque Wrench: Always use a torque wrench to tighten wheel bolts to the manufacturer’s specifications.
- Regular Inspections: Check the tightness of wheel bolts periodically, especially after driving on rough terrain.
- Proper Installation: Follow the correct sequence when tightening bolts to ensure even pressure distribution.
- Monitor Road Conditions: Be aware of road conditions and adjust driving habits accordingly to minimize excessive vibration.

How Often Should Wheel Bolts Be Checked?
Wheel bolts should be checked regularly, ideally every time you change your tires or at least once a month. This ensures they remain tight and secure.
Can Loose Wheel Bolts Cause Damage?
Yes, loose wheel bolts can lead to wheel detachment, which can cause significant damage to the vehicle and pose a safety risk to the driver and others on the road.
What Tools Are Needed to Tighten Wheel Bolts?
A torque wrench is essential for tightening wheel bolts to the correct specifications. Additionally, a socket set may be required to fit the specific bolt size.
What Are the Signs of Loose Wheel Bolts?
Common signs include vibrations in the steering wheel, unusual noises from the wheels, and a feeling of instability while driving.
Can Wheel Bolts Loosen on Their Own?
Yes, wheel bolts can loosen over time due to factors like thermal expansion, vibration, and improper initial installation.
